YOU NO LONGER COME BACK FOR YOUR PASSPORT - We have received several reports since November 2011 that Chonburi Immigration has changed the process. A lady sitting next to the Sgt. at Desk 6 will now take your documents and enter information into the computer before collecting your fee and giving your packet to the Sgt. He will affix the required stamps in your passport. The Lady Captain that sits behind him will review the documents, sign the extension stamp, and give you back your passport, everything completed.
That's how it exactly happened for me last March and for my friend two days ago.
I think it really depends on circumstances.... numbers of people in the office, computer down, authorized person being present, etc...
Note: we both had no problems with change being returned.

My understanding is they have a special department to investigate foreign criminals. I am just speculating and can't think of any other reason why they hold the passports, except perhaps to annoy people and force us to take an extra trip there.The paranoid side of me says to check police records.
Wouldn't you think they can check that on a computer while they're processing the application?
the applications are normally countersigned by the super at the end of each day or in the morning
however the last person to inspect the application has the authority to sign off on it if they wish and can give you the passport back there and then.
much will depend on whether you are a long termer with a number of previous extensions, you have had a few years with no changed address details and how you have presented and conducted yourself during the process
if they think you qualify as a low risk renewal with a good history, you will not need to go back to get it.......
